I was checking out the OST for The Witch's House yesterday, and I found out that the True Ending music is called "Miller House". And since Ellen's house is the only house in the game, could this be a possible hint that our faithful witch's full name is Ellen Miller?

It’s possible. Miller is an English/Scottish last name, but also a profession, so it could either or. But the last name sounds nicer

